\pi-\bold{pi}\\\\\pi\ \text{it's the ratio of a circle's circumference to its diameter}\\\\\pi=\dfrac{\text{circumference of a circle}}{\text{circle diameter}}\\\\\pi\ \text{it's irrarional number}\\\\\pi=3.14159265358979323846264338327...\\\\\text{Approximation of}\ \pi:\\\\\pi\approx3.14\\\\\pi\approx\dfrac{22}{7}\\\\\pi\approx\dfrac{355}{113}

The number pi occurs when calculating the surface area or volume of the rotational solids.

Cylinder:

S.A.=2\pi r^2+2\pi rH\\\\V=\pi r^2H

Cone:

S.A.=\pi r^2+\pi rl\\\\V=\dfrac{1}{3}\pi r^2H

Sphere:

S.A.=4\pi R^2\\\\V=\dfrac{4}{3}\pi R^3

The number pi occurs when calculating the area and the circumference of a circle.

C=\pi d=2\pi r\\\\A=\pi r^2

It is also used to convert angle measure in degrees to radians.

x^o=\dfrac{x\pi}{180}\ rad
